Since its establishment in 1972, the Sandra Cheal School of Dancing in Colchester has been offering dance classes to students of all ages and levels. With a team of experienced teachers, the school aims to help students reach their full potential in a supportive environment.
The school provides various classes, including Ballet, Tap, Modern/Contemporary, and Gymnastic Dance. From Baby Ballet to Adult Tap, there are options for everyone. Lessons are designed to be both educational and enjoyable. Students can also take I.D.T.A. Examinations and join in the school show.
The founding Principal, Sheila Leach, started the school with just 15 pupils. Sheila retired in October 2020, and Sarah Kemp stepped in as the new Principal. Sarah, along with her son Nick Kemp, Claudia Black, and Sophie Knights, now form the teaching team. All of them are former students of the school, reflecting their long-term commitment to dance.
